Transaction 7573a84db4510f028849379a62bdeaffe0df1ab7e4b6de8015b19cbf327f5b42

1 Input
2 Outputs
  • 7573a84db4510f028849379a62bdeaffe0df1ab7e4b6de8015b19cbf327f5b42:0
  • value  1007930
    address  3HzLneHHKvgB4rnoV78qVYwUVZRaLSiWuo
  • 7573a84db4510f028849379a62bdeaffe0df1ab7e4b6de8015b19cbf327f5b42:1
  • value  148070
    address  15fXUbKNxo9xjnyxmtCiZgYfajYZhXRJnA